The Marsh Babbler (Pellorneum palustre) is a bird species in the family Pellorneidae, within the order Passeriformes (sperlingsvögel). Recorded measurements include a wingspan of 12.6 cm and a weight of 21.5 g. The IUCN Red List classifies it as Vulnerable.
